TIA-598-C 1 Optical Fiber Cable Color Coding 1 Scope This standard defines the recommended identification scheme or system for individual fibers, fiber units, and groups of fiber units within a cable structure. The methods contained herein may be used to identify and locate
29、specific fibers for the purpose of connection, termination, or testing within a communication system or for the topography of long haul, feeder route, subscriber, or distribution applications for both on-premises and outside plant use. This standard also defines the optical fiber type identification
30、 scheme for color coding or marking jackets for premises cables used primarily indoors. Cables with colored jackets are typically used only in intrabuilding applications and must be listed to a level of fire resistance specific to their use. The jacket materials used can be colored for identificatio
31、n purposes. Conversely, most cables deployed outdoors must incorporate additives in the jacket material to be able to withstand the damaging effects of solar radiation over their designed operating lifetime. Such products typically contain carbon black material to provide the requisite level of prot
32、ection, which precludes the use of any jacket color other than black. Although color-compatible materials designed to resist solar radiation are available for outdoor use, and other means for color-coding black jackets are possible (i.e., colored striping), the use of such materials and methods are
33、beyond the scope of this standard. 2 Normative references The following standards contain provisions which, through references in this text, constitute provisions of this Standard. 39、for low-frequency cables and wires 3 Fiber, unit, and group color coding Each individual fiber within a fiber optic cable shall be uniquely identifiable in terms of its color, unit, group, and/or position. The following scheme applies to cables in which the fibers are physically separated. For cable
40、s in which individual fibers are identified by fixed positional configuration (e.g., some ribbon cable, slotted core), this color scheme is preferred but is not mandatory. TIA-598-C 3 3.1 Individual fibers All fibers shall be discernibly and uniquely color coded using the preferred method in accorda
41、nce with one of the alternatives given in Table 1, or the surrogate method given in annex C (informative), Table C-11). The identification may be by coloring, by printed legend, by printed block coding, or by other unique methods meeting the intent of this Paragraph and as agreed upon by the manufac
42、turer and the user. If a printed legend is used in lieu of actual color coding for identification, the legend shall consist of the numerical position number or the color abbreviation, or both, as listed in Table 1. If printed block coding is used, it shall consist of printed blocks and bar or hachur
43、e marks corresponding to the numerical position. A sample scheme is illustrated in Table 2; this marking scheme may be extended as necessary. 3.2 Fiber units Units are primary groupings of individual fibers. Examples of units include, but are not limited to: buffer tubes which contain individual fib
44、ers; multi-fiber ribbons; fibers bundled by threads or tape; and the slots of slotted-core cables, when the fibers within each slot are not otherwise grouped or connected. When a number of fibers (e.g., 6, 12, 18, or 24) form a unit, the unit shall be uniquely identified in accordance with one of th
45、e alternatives given in Table 1 or Table C-1 as described in 3.1. 3.3 Fiber groups Groups are collections of units. Examples of groups include, but are not limited to: buffer tubes which contain ribbons, bundled fibers, or other fiber units; the slots of slotted-core cables, when the fibers in each
46、slot are grouped in units such as ribbons; and ribbons which are assembled from two or more smaller ribbons. When a number of units form a group, the group may be uniquely identified in accordance with one of the alternatives given in Table 1 or Table C-1 as described in 3.1. 1) Table C-1 uses the I
47、EC color abbreviations.
